Most sexually active people in the United States engage in MouthAction. Matter-of-factly, to many, MouthAction is more pleasurable than genital penetration. In America, different slangs have been coined for MouthAction – Mouth Action, Go-Down-South, Go-Down, Get-A-Head, 69-Position and the list goes on. For those who care about medical terminology, Cunnilingus refers to MouthAction performed on females while MouthAction refers to MouthAction performed on males.

For the most part, majority of Africans (especially African men) shun MouthAction either for religious, cultural or traditional reasons. The few that engage in it will deny it vehemently in public because they see it as a disdainful “girly-man” sexual activity. A real man should be able to give a woman the same pleasure using his sex organ, they will argue. In Nigeria for example, there are different denigrating words for describing men that perform MouthAction on women.

However, many African men who are married to Westerners would tell you they have no choice performing MouthAction on their partners. Some African women on the other hand who will like to have MouthAction with their partner shy away from saying it because they do not want to be labeled as being “spoilt” or sexually perverted which might lead to the ruin of their relationship.

Maybe not the younger Africans; but the middle-aged and older Africans (male and female alike) in the Western World have given reasons (real or fabricated) for refusing to engage in MouthAction. Many will tell you it is bad (without any scientific proof) but based on what they heard from their parents or other adults in Africa.

In recent weeks, the claim by Michael Douglas’ (America famous actor) that MouthAction might be the cause of his throat cancer has shed light on the “safety” of MouthAction. In a candid interview with the Guardian newspaper, the actor said that he didn't regret his years of smoking and drinking, which were thought to be the cause of his cancer when he was diagnosed three years ago. "No Because without wanting to get too specific, this particular cancer is caused by HPV [Human Papillomavirus], which actually comes about from cunnilingus," he said.
